Bang & Olufsen pronounces future-proof Beosound A9 and Beosound 2 audio system

2 min read

Bang & Olufsen has introduced new and extra future-proof variations of its Beosound A9 and Beosound 2 audio system.

The primary Beosound A9 launched method again in 2012, with a memorably fashionable free-standing round design from Oivind Slaatto. We reviewed it again within the day, and located it to be fairly darned spectacular.

B&O’s new fifth technology mannequin retains the traditional look of the speaker, however provides within the firm’s newest Mozart software program to make it future-proof. The speaker now include a replaceable module, which is “frontloaded with sufficient processing energy to obtain software program updates and options for a few years to come back”.

The thought is that when these inside elements do grow to be out of date, the module can merely be swapped out for a extra updated model. Different enhancements embody a brand new trio of finishes: Black Anthracite, Gold Tone and Pure Aluminum.

The Beosound 2 is the third technology of the corporate’s compact multi-room speaker, which initially launched again in 2016. Just like the Beosound A9 (fifth Gen), the Beosound 2 (third Gen) seems to be loads like the unique, with a well-known high-grade aluminium conical design that appears prefer it might have come straight from the Dying Star.

Like its massive brother, the important thing enhancements with the brand new Beosound 2 are inside. As soon as once more, B&O has applied its Mozart modular software program system, which may see its key internals swapped out in some unspecified time in the future sooner or later when requirements of efficiency and connectivity have sufficiently superior.

There’s a brand new Black Anthracite end to accompany the traditional Gold Tone and Pure, too.

Extra consequentially, Bang & Olufsen has improved the Beosound 2’s consumer interface, whereas Lively Room Compensation permits the speaker to detect its place within the room and distribute its sound accordingly. It’s a function that makes it higher outfitted to fend off cheaper rivals just like the Sonos Period 100 and the Apple HomePod.

Pricing for the Beosound A9 (fifth Gen) begins at £2,899 / €3,299 / $3,699, and can be on sale in-store and on-line from March. The Beosound 2 third Gen begins at £2,649 / €2,999 / $3,199, and can be occurring sale in April.
